I have only owned one semi-auto pistol in my life.
It was a Colt and I was raised shooting a 1911 ACP.
My first mis-fire was the second round in the clip from factory ammo. The next round failed to go to battery. After disassembling the gun and stoning all the burrs off every moving part, I got it as good as it ever shot.
I never did get that gun to shoot reliably. The best was about 95%. 1 or 2 rounds for each magazine would fail to feed or the slide would not return to battery. Maybe it was just a bad gun.
I carry a revolver because I have never had a failure to fire or a failure to feed. I got the same accuracy with both guns and I enjoyed shooting both. I did not like hunting for my brass after firing each target with the auto-loader in order to reload.
I shoot a lot and I reload. I prefer revolvers to semi's hands down. I always will.
